Is this your first trip?

The Unofficial Guide strategies do work - not that many people use them in relation to the total crowd at WDW at any given time

The busier the parks, the more helpful the strategies are as well

If you like starting early in the mornings then a strategy might be to go to the early entry park each day (except your arrival day) and take advantage of the early entry and then leave that park late morning and either return to POR for a swim and lunch or go to another park to avoid the crowds that will build up at the EE park

Hi Cinda Indiana,

I wrote the computer software the Unofficial Guide uses for its touring plans. Based on extensive testing, I'm fairly certain that the touring plans will work well. On any given day, less than 1% of the folks in the parks will be using the Guide's touring plans, so you should be able to stay well ahead of the pack.

Just back. Having read almost every guide out there before my trip, I can honestly say that more than half the people I saw in the parks had no clue where they were, what they wanted to do next, or where the crowds would be heaviest! Do read the guides and use the plans! Having studied the maps before the trip was such a help- I forgot to get a map before MK EMH :eek: , but knew the park so well touring was a breeze. (We did slow down when DS6 found a map and decided to lead us through the park :p !. Also knowing the rides that are fast loading/ short lines mid-day helps when your waiting for your Fastpass window. There's no point in getting a Fastpass if you don't have something fun to do with the hour/ 2 hour wait!
 
I use the guides in the unofficial guide and agree with Jean. Most people stand in the middle of the street looking at maps wondering what to do next. We always seemed to stay one step ahead of the masses. I copy the guide for each day and use the huge index cards to paste them on, then laminate it. Honey and son thought I was way to obsessive but the amount of time I saved NOT waiting in lines they were thrilled.
